The Defense Logistics Agency is seeking a Total Small Business Set-Aside for the procurement of 22 PIVOT-SHAFT ASSEMBLY RA001 units under solicitation SPE4A7-26-Q-0820, with a NAICS code of 332710 and a 250-day delivery window after order date. The contract is firm fixed price, with an estimated cost of $8,274.00 for the Government’s first article test, which will be added to the offered price, and all deliveries must occur at the destination with FOB destination terms. Inspection occurs at the origin while acceptance takes place at the destination, and the contractor must deliver first article test units within 250 days, followed by a 150-day government evaluation period, with final production delivery due another 250 days after FAT approval. Technical and quality requirements are governed by the D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ements, with specific emphasis on packaging per RP001, marking per MIL-STD-129, and handling of hazardous materials in accordance with FED-STD-313 and ASTM D3951, unless superseded by DLA requirements. Export control applies to technical data under ITAR or EAR, restricting disclosure to foreign persons without authorization, and only contractors with approved JCP certification, training completion, and DLA access clearance may handle such data. Cybersecurity compliance requires CMMC Level 2 certification by a C3PAO, and safeguarding of covered defense information is mandated under DFARS 252.204-7012 and 252.204-7008, with additional compliance for prohibition on covered telecommunications equipment and hexavalent chromium. The contractor must flow down clauses related to trafficking in persons, information system safeguarding, and prohibitions on ByteDance and unmanned aircraft systems from covered foreign entities. Payment is electronic via WAWF, with accelerated payments directed to small business subcontractors, and all invoicing must align with Government requirements for receiving reports and cost vouchers. The contractor is subject to the Defense Priorities and Allocations System (DPAS) DO rating, requiring priority performance for national defense purposes, and must also ensure compliance with sustainable product standards, prompt payment terms, whistleblower rights notification, and removal of government identification from non-accepted supplies. The Defense Logistics Agency, through DLA Land and Maritime, has issued Request for Quotations SPE7L7-26-Q-2412 for the procurement of 100 nickel-cadmium wet storage batteries (NSN 6140-01-241-2296). These batteries are specified as wet, discharged, and spillable, with a non-extendable shelf life of 36 months. Approved sources include Aerodesign, Inc. (P/N AD-31004-04C) and Marathonnorco Aerospace, Inc. (P/N 31004-04C). The items are to be delivered to the Royal Saudi Air Force within 60 days after the order date. This is a fixed-price solicitation where award will be based on the best value to the government, evaluating technical conformity, past performance, and offered delivery time. Because the batteries are classified as corrosive materials (UN2795), the contractor must strictly adhere to hazardous materials regulations, including ICAO, IMDG, 49 CFR, and AFJMAN 24-204. Packaging must comply with MIL-STD-2073-1E Level B, Pack Code Q, using 4G fiber-board boxes. Inspection will be conducted by DCMA at the distributor or OEM site, with acceptance occurring at the origin. Administrative requirements include the use of the Wide Area WorkFlow system for electronic invoicing and receiving reports. The contract incorporates various FAR and DFARS clauses, including the Buy American and Balance of Payments Program and strict cybersecurity reporting requirements under DFARS 252.204-7012. Quotes must be submitted electronically by the deadline of September 17, 2026.
